OWNER & CEO
James Frisby is the founder of FASST Sports Performance Training Program in Winchester, Va. FASST was founded to impact the youth in our community through speed, agility, strength, and conditioning along with confidence, character building, and mental toughness. James brings with him over 17 years of experience in the fitness industry.
Certifications:
NASM, CPT (Certified Personal Trainer)
NASM, PES (Performance Enhancement Specialist)
NASM, CES (Corrective Exercise Specialist)
NASM, YES (Youth Exercise Specialist)
James has been fortunate to train some of the top high school, collegiate and professional athletes in the VA/DC Metro area. He really enjoys helping athletes excel, not just in sports, but also as a driving force in life.
The need for speed, agility, strength, explosiveness, quickness, body control, and reaction all contribute to an athlete’s success. FASST Training programs have increased the emphasis on improving playing speed and utilizing speed in all sport movements. This includes starting, stopping, cutting, accelerating, changing direction, delivering or avoiding a blow, sprinting, and split-second decision making during sports competition.
James’ goal is to provide young athletes with the best opportunity to excel and enhance their skill and ability to perform and compete at any level. He is devoted to teach kids ways of reaching their peak potential and believes athletes can improve in all areas. Although genetics is important, heredity only deals the cards; environment and hard training play the hand.

DIRECTOR OF SPORTS PERFORMANCE
Tucker graduated with his undergraduate degree in Exercise Science and Masters degree in Organizational Leadership from Shenandoah University. He is also a certified strength and conditioning specialist (CSCS) and has multiple years of experience in the industry.
Tucker’s athletic background is in track and field, more specifically in the throwing events. Tucker became a 3 time All-American with his best performance being a 3rd place finish in the weight throw at NCAA division 3 nationals. His accolades also include numerous conference titles in hammer, weight throw, and shot put along with plenty of other all conference and all region finishes.
Tucker loves FASST because it brings the required environment and structure for any athlete to become the greatest version of themselves.
